I just upgraded to the next one up and tried to compile from then. You have to use concurrent compilers with the date of portage, for best results. > Thanks. I'll try going upgrading portage version-by-version. One other thing I did, after a few of these. I dropped the profile down to the basic (default) for me that's [1] default/linux/amd64 Once a system is updated you can move your world file back, or portions of it and enhance the profile as you like. There are other things like the location of portage that can cause minor issues. Also look at the old news items if you get stumped on something. They are dated so you can coordinate with the date of the portage you are on as you update, for any other gotchas..... Sometimes a fresh install is a good idea.
